Case Page

 

Case Status:    DISMISSED    
On or around 03/14/2012 (Notice of voluntarily dismissal)

Filing Date: August 11, 2009

Align Technology, Inc. ("Align" or the Company) is a medical device company that designs, manufactures, and markets devices to treat misaligned teeth. The Company’s principal products are the Invisalign clear dental aligners and the iTero® (“iTero”) intraoral scanners, which are used to create digital imagery of patients’ teeth for the purposes of diagnosing misalignment and fitting Invisalign aligners.

According to a press release dated August 24, 2009, the Complaint alleges that throughout the Class Period, Defendants knew or recklessly disregarded that their public statements concerning Align's business, operations and prospects were materially false and misleading. Specifically, the Complaint alleges that during the Class Period, Defendants failed to disclose or indicate that the Company had shifted the focus of its sales force to clearing backlog, causing a significant decrease in the number of new case starts. Consequently, Defendants' misleading statements and omission of materially adverse information rendered their Class Period statements concerning the Company's business, operations and financial prospects materially false and misleading at all relevant times.

On November 13, 2009, an order appointing lead Plaintiff and lead Counsel were entered into the court docket.

On January 29, 2010, an amended class action Complaint was filed by the Plaintiffs against the Defendants.

On March 14, 2012, a Stipulation was entered into the Court's docket. The parties stipulate to the dismissal of this action with prejudice.
